Abstract

The utility model discloses a beauty instrument which comprises a mirror, a rear cover, a lamp panel with an LED lamp, a lens plate with a condensing lens, a fixing plate for preventing the lens plate from moving and a front panel, the mirror is attached to the back face of the rear cover, the lamp panel is installed in the rear cover, the lens plate covers the LED lamp, and the condensing lens is aligned to the LED lamp. A through hole matched with the condensing lens is formed in the fixing plate, and the condensing lens is embedded in the through hole; and the front panel covers the rear cover. The beauty instrument can be used as a mirror, and the beauty effect of the beauty instrument can be adjusted by controlling the wavelength of the LED lamp light source. When the beauty instrument is used as a mirror, the beauty instrument is provided with the illuminating lamp and has better effect. The support assembly of the beauty instrument is of a detachable structure and can be dismounted or mounted according to different use scenes of consumers, and the magnetic dismounting structure is convenient and fast to operate. The sheath of the beauty instrument not only can protect the mirror and the front panel from being worn, but also can be used as a bracket.

TECHNICAL FIELD

[0001] The utility model relates to a cosmetic instrument, LED lamp technical field, specifically relates to a cosmetic instrument. BACKGROUND

[0002] The red light therapeutic instrument can be used for beauty care and health care according to the effective treatment of red light spectrum, and the functions are simply summarized as follows: whitening and tendering skin, tightening and anti-aging, moisturizing, acne removal and soothing.

[0003] The light source of the intelligent high-power multifunctional large-row lamp cosmetic instrument is a new type of composite light combined by LED red light, yellow light, infrared light, green light and blue light, which is simply referred to as LED cosmetic light.

[0004] The cosmetic instrument belongs to a high-tech nanometer technology cosmetic instrument, uses fixed diode emitted light (630nm red light, yellow light 590nm, near infrared 830nm, etc.) to replace laser to dilate and strengthen microvessels, so as to achieve the effects of promoting blood circulation, increasing active oxygen and accelerating detoxification.

[0005] The patent 201720493033.3 a LED desk lamp with cosmetic function, although it also includes LED light source, lens assembly and support, but the LED desk lamp is switched through the lens assembly that can slide relative to the surface of the LED light source, to adjust the exit angle and light spectrum of the LED desk lamp, and realize the adjustment of the light type. It can be used for ordinary reading illumination, and also can be used for cosmetic illumination. That is to say, the design is realized by sliding to realize the functions of reading illumination and cosmetic illumination, therefore, the light source adjusting range is limited, and it can only be adjusted by physical gear shifting. UTILITY MODEL CONTENT

[0006] In order to solve the above technical problems, the utility model provides a cosmetic instrument which is simple in structure, beautiful in appearance and effective in adjusting the cosmetic effect by controlling the wavelength of the LED light source.

[0007] The utility model solves the above technical problems in the following scheme:

[0008] The cosmetic instrument comprises a mirror, a rear cover, a lamp plate with LED lamps, a lens plate with condenser lenses, a fixing plate for preventing the lens plate from moving and a front panel, the mirror is attached to the back of the rear cover, the lamp plate is installed in the rear cover, the lens plate covers the LED lamps, and the condenser lenses are aligned with the LED lamps, the fixing plate is provided with through holes matched with the condenser lenses, the condenser lenses are embedded in the through holes, and the front panel covers the rear cover. The back of the cosmetic instrument is attached with the mirror, so that it can be used as a mirror in ordinary environment. The front of the cosmetic instrument is the emission area of the LED lamps, and the wavelength of the LED light source is controlled to adjust the cosmetic effect of the cosmetic instrument.

[0009] Furthermore, the mirror has a light-transmitting area on the back that is not covered by mercury, and the back cover has light-transmitting holes that correspond to this area. A row of horizontal lights is located on the back of the light panel to illuminate the face. This lighting design enhances the user's mirror experience and is more suitable for dimly lit conditions.

[0010] Furthermore, the beauty device also includes a detachable support assembly, which includes a foldable protective sleeve, a first iron bar, and a second iron bar; one end of the protective sleeve is clamped between the first iron bar and the second iron bar, one end of the protective sleeve is detachably connected to the top surface of the back cover, and the other end of the protective sleeve sequentially covers the mirror, the bottom surface of the back cover, and the front panel.

[0011] The top surface of the back cover has an inwardly recessed groove for accommodating the second iron bar, and a receiving groove for accommodating the magnet is provided below the groove. The magnet and the second iron bar attract each other, so that the support assembly can be detachably connected to the beauty device.

[0012] This design utilizes magnets to attract the second iron bar, allowing for easy removal and replacement of the protective cover to meet the aesthetic needs of different consumers. The cover also protects the mirror and front panel from scratches and wear. Furthermore, when in use, the cover can function as a support, allowing the beauty device to stand upright on a table, and the angle can be adjusted to suit the user's needs, making it convenient and practical.

[0013] Furthermore, the first iron bar extends downward with a positioning post, the second iron bar is provided with a first positioning hole, and the sheath is provided with a clearance hole coaxial with the first positioning hole. The positioning post passes through the clearance hole and is inserted into the first positioning hole.

[0014] Furthermore, there are N lens plates, where N≥1, and each lens plate is provided with a second positioning hole, the lamp plate is provided with a third positioning hole, the fixing plate is provided with a fourth positioning hole, and the rear cover is provided with studs that pass through the third positioning hole, the second positioning hole and the fourth positioning hole in sequence. The positioning screw passes through the fixing plate and is screwed into the stud, and the fixing plate and the rear cover are fixedly connected.

[0015] Furthermore, the focusing lens has a convex lens structure, which further focuses the light and enhances the cosmetic effect.

[0016] Furthermore, the wavelength of the LED light is 630nm, 590nm, 415nm, 465nm, 525nm, 830nm, 940nm or 1024nm.

[0017] Red light spectrum wavelength: 630nm

[0018] Yellow light spectrum wavelength: 590nm

[0019] Blue light spectrum wavelength: 415nm / 465nm

[0020] Green light spectrum wavelength: 525nm

[0021] Infrared light 830nm / 940nm / 1024nm

[0022] Furthermore, the front panel is a polymer lens with circular textures.

[0023] Furthermore, the beauty device also includes a speaker, which is mounted on the back cover and has a sound outlet on the front panel.

[0024] Furthermore, the sheath is a leather case.

[0043] Example 1:

[0044] like Figure 1 , Figure 2 The beauty device 10 shown includes a mirror 1, a back cover 2, a light panel 4 with LED lights 3, a lens plate 6 with a focusing lens 5, a fixing plate 7 to prevent the lens plate 6 from moving, and a front panel 8. The mirror 1 is attached to the back of the back cover 2, the light panel 4 is installed inside the back cover 2, the lens plate 6 covers the LED lights 3, and the focusing lens 5 is aligned with the LED lights 3. The fixing plate 7 is provided with a through hole 71 that matches the focusing lens 5, and the focusing lens 5 is fitted into the through hole 71. The front panel 8 covers the back cover 2.

[0045] The back of the beauty device 10 is fitted with a mirror 1, so it can be used as a mirror in normal environments. The front of the beauty device 10 is the area from which the LED light 3 is emitted; the beauty effect of the beauty device 10 is adjusted by controlling the wavelength of the LED light 3.

[0046] In this embodiment, as Figure 3 , Figure 4As shown, the back of the mirror 1 has a light-transmitting area 11 that is not covered with mercury, and the back cover 2 has light-transmitting holes 21 that cooperate with the light-transmitting area 11. The back of the lamp panel 4 has a row of horizontal lights 41 for illuminating the face. The design of the lights 41 makes the user's experience of looking in the mirror 1 better and is more suitable for situations with low light.

[0047] In this embodiment, as Figure 1 , Figure 5 As shown, the beauty device 10 also includes a detachable support assembly 9, which includes a foldable protective sleeve 91, a first iron bar 92, and a second iron bar 93; one end of the protective sleeve 91 is sandwiched between the first iron bar 92 and the second iron bar 93, and one end of the protective sleeve 91 is detachably connected to the top surface of the back cover 2, and the other end of the protective sleeve 91 sequentially covers the mirror 1, the bottom surface of the back cover 2, and the front panel 8;

[0048] like Figure 5 , Figure 6 , Figure 7 As shown, the top surface of the back cover 2 is recessed inward to accommodate the second iron bar 93. Below the groove 22, there is a receiving slot 23 for accommodating the magnet 24. The magnet 24 and the second iron bar 93 attract each other, so that the bracket assembly 9 is detachably connected to the beauty device 10.

[0049] This design utilizes the attraction between magnet 24 and the second iron bar 93, allowing for easy disassembly and replacement of the protective cover 91 to meet the aesthetic needs of different consumers. The protective cover 91 also prevents scratches or wear on the mirror 1 and the front panel 8. Furthermore, when in use, the protective cover 91 can serve as a support, allowing the beauty device 10 to stand upright on a table, and its angle can be adjusted according to the user's needs, making it convenient and practical.

[0050] In this embodiment, as Figure 6 , Figure 9 As shown, the first iron bar 92 extends downward with a positioning post 94, the second iron bar 93 is provided with a first positioning hole 95, and the sheath 91 is provided with a clearance hole 96 coaxial with the first positioning hole 95. The positioning post 94 passes through the clearance hole 96 and is inserted into the first positioning hole 95.

[0051] In this embodiment, as Figure 5 , Figure 7 , Figure 10 As shown, there are 20 lens plates 6, and each lens plate 6 is provided with a second positioning hole 61. The lamp plate 4 is provided with a third positioning hole 42, and the fixing plate 7 is provided with a fourth positioning hole 72. The rear cover 2 is provided with studs 25 that pass through the third positioning hole 42, the second positioning hole 61 and the fourth positioning hole 72 in sequence. The positioning screws (not shown in the figure) pass through the fixing plate 7 and are screwed into the studs 25. The fixing plate 7 and the rear cover 2 are fixedly connected.

[0052] In this embodiment, as Figure 2 As shown, the focusing lens 5 has a convex lens structure. This allows for better focus of the light, enhancing the cosmetic effect.

[0053] In this embodiment, the wavelength of the LED light 3 can be 630nm, 590nm, 415nm, 465nm, 525nm, 830nm, 940nm, or 1024nm. Different beauty effects can be controlled by adjusting the wavelength of the LED light 3, for example:

[0054] Red light spectrum wavelength: 630nm

[0055] Yellow light spectrum wavelength: 590nm

[0056] Blue light spectrum wavelength: 415nm / 465nm

[0057] Green light spectrum wavelength: 525nm

[0058] Infrared light 830nm / 940nm / 1024nm

[0059] In this embodiment, as Figure 2 As shown, the front panel 8 is a polymer lens with circular textures.

[0060] In this embodiment, as Figure 2 , Figure 10 As shown, the beauty device 10 also includes a speaker 11, which is mounted on the back cover 2, and the front panel 8 has a sound outlet 12.

[0061] In this embodiment, the sheath 91 is a leather case.
